Swale Installation in Birmingham, AL
Swale installation services involve designing and constructing channels or ditches to manage surface water runoff around residential properties. These systems help direct excess water away from foundations, gardens, driveways, and other areas prone to flooding or erosion. Projects can range from simple shallow ditches to more complex, landscaped channels that integrate seamlessly with existing landscaping. Homeowners typically seek swale installation when experiencing issues with standing water, water pooling after storms, or concerns about soil erosion, aiming to protect their property and maintain proper drainage.
Before requesting swale installation, property owners should consider factors such as the layout of their land, the natural flow of water, and any local regulations or permits that may be required. It’s important to assess the property’s topography and identify the most effective locations for water diversion. Understanding the scope of the project, including the size and depth of the swale, helps ensure the system functions as intended and addresses specific drainage challenges. Proper planning can improve water management and prevent potential water damage around the property.

Swale Installation Questions
What is a swale? A swale is a shallow, vegetated ditch designed to manage stormwater runoff and reduce erosion around a property.
Why install a swale? Swales help direct water away from foundations, prevent flooding, and improve drainage on residential or commercial sites.
What materials are used for swale installation? Typically, natural materials like soil, grass, and rocks are used, often with plantings to promote water absorption and stability.
Is a swale suitable for any property? Swale installation is effective on properties with drainage issues or uneven terrain, but suitability depends on site conditions and landscape goals.
